A shaft secured to a hub is inserted and rotatably supported in a sleeve secured
to a base. A dynamic pressure groove is formed in the inner peripheral surface
of the sleeve, and lubricant is sealed between the shaft and the sleeve. The rotation
of the shaft causes dynamic pressure to generate in the lubricant due to the dynamic
pressure groove, supporting the shaft floatingly. The crystallized-glass sleeve
allows heat generated in a coil to be hardly transferred to the shaft, thereby
reducing the variations in the clearance between the shaft and the sleeve due to
temperature changes to a minimum in cooperation with the crystallized-glass sleeve
with a low thermal expansion coefficient. Finishing accuracy of the bearing surface
can be improved by chemical polishing. Consequently, the rotation accuracy can
be improved and the leakage of lubricant due to the variations in the clearance
can be prevented.
